Letters Eradicating poverty
This is with reference to that article "Our generation can choose to end extreme poverty by 2025" (Business Line, April 23). The Finance Minister, Mr P. Chidambaram, is reported to have said that the aim of the government was to end extreme poverty by 2015. But why should we wait so long? For instance, starvation deaths, children dying due to malnutrition and disease etc are all preventable. It all depends on whether we have the will to do so. If someone in power makes it their mission to eradicate extreme poverty, the government and the people will definitely come forward with their support. But the time to start is now. A. Jacob Sahayam Thiruvananthapuram
